NOTE: In some applications, especially those requiring the motor to cycle on and
off or changing from one speed to another, the OL indicator may blink indicating a
transient overload. This may be a normal condition for the application.

X. OPTIONAL ACCESSORIES

A. RUN-STOP-JOG Switch (P/N 9340) – This switch provides a momentary jog speed that

can be used to "inch" a machine into position. It assembles easily to the control via quick
connect terminals. A rubber switch seal is included in order to maintain watertight
integrity.

B. Signal Isolator (Model KBSI-240D, P/N 9431) – Signal isolation is required when a

remote nonisolated analog signal is to be used. Provision is made to install Model KBSI-
240D on 4 bosses inside the front cover. The unit accepts a variety of voltage and current
signals. Note: Forward-Brake-Reverse Switch (P/N 9339) cannot be installed with
Signal Isolator.

C. Auto/Manual Installation Kit (P/N 9377) – This kit facilitates mounting of KBSI-240D

Signal Isolator onto KBPC-225. Contains Auto/Man Switch and necessary wiring and
hardware. (KBSI-240D, P/N 9431, purchased separately.)

Note: ON/OFF AC Line Switch, manual and electronic armature reversing with braking are

not currently available for this product. Consult factory for future availability.
